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
99 433250259 14827
19191945284 7712184339
19191945284 7712184339
6266 18 70
All about undefined
Interested in learning more?
19191945284 7712184339
6266 18 70
See more
4204984 48 429281
791521838 3505295 6136431999
See more
171918 12450221 1224131
1456072292 818699 863
See more